More Myanmar Junta Bases Fall on Second Day of ShanAttacks
The MNDAA said it occupied three junta outposts near Xiao Xin Fan and Nanghang villages on Saturday morning, seizing arms and ammunition. It added that it then ambushed junta troops on the Chinshwehaw-Hopang road near the Chinese border. The group said many regime troops were detained and killed.
